As FCT Water Board Management Embraces Public Awareness, By Ibrahim Biu

For the first time since it was created, the management of the FCT Water Board has taken bold steps to create public awareness about its activities as a way of carrying along the workforce.
The Board’s management has also been trying, apart from the creation of public awareness, to involve all stakeholders in the board’s activities with a view to moving it forward for the purpose of achieving its overall objectives of producing adequate portable water in line with the saying: “water is life.”
It has been noticed that within the past six months or so, the FCT Water Board has taken adequate measures to improve the quality and quantity of water being produced and supplied for human and animal consumption in the FCT. This has been hailed in many quarters as a commendable effort. Many residents have confirmed that water being produced in Abuja is of high quality.
The management of the board has since the assumption of Madam Joy Okoro as its General Manager and team leader, not only embarked upon executing people-oriented projects but arranged for series of interactive sessions and public lectures all over the place to sensitize the public about its activities. The media people are not left out as many of them have been constantly properly briefed and involved in providing publicity and public enlightenment about the board’s activities.
It will be recalled that last Tuesday, the management of the board, while celebrating the international water day, carried out massive publicity and public enlightenment as well as public lectures with stakeholders. The board provided the public with enough information on what it had been doing to improve the water situation in Abuja.
During the interactive session, Mrs. Joy appealed to the public to cooperate with the board on all issues relating to the production and distribution of water.
The General Manager made it clear to the public and even the media the importance of the people, especially the corporate organization promptly paying water bills which she said, will augment the efforts of the board in handling its affairs.
She did not mince word in telling the public that the provision of clean water helps in reducing the incidents of the outbreak of water borne diseases.
